ˌfull ˈhouse noun [countableC usually singular] 1 FULLan occasion at a cinema, concert hall, sports field etc when there are no empty seats 〔电影院、音乐厅、体育场等的〕满座,满席,客满 Billy Graham is a speaker who can be sure of playing to a full house. 葛培理是一位能保证满座的演说家。
2. DGCthree cards of one kind and a pair of another kind in a game of poker 〔纸牌戏中的〕满堂红,满贯〔一手牌中三张点数相同,另外两张点数相同〕
